    How much can my stock internals take?

    I have a 99 SS with a MTI Heads & Cam pckg. already pushing 419rwhp and am looking at a procharger d-1sc intercooled kit. Since I already have more power I was going to start off with 5psi. Is this too much for my stock internals? Really don't want to pull the motor and build it up. Low miles only 30k.
